The public middle schools with the highest share of Asian students in Fayette County, Georgia
This ranking covers the public middle schools with the highest share of Asian students in Fayette County, Georgia, drawn from 6 qualifying public middle schools. J.C. Booth Middle School leads the list at 15.9%, against a median of 4.6% across the ranked schools.

| # | School | City | % Asian |
|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| J.C. Booth Middle School | Peachtree City, GA | 15.9%(177) |
| 2 | Rising Starr Middle School | Fayetteville, GA | 6.8%(63) |
| 3 | Bennett's Mill Middle School | Fayetteville, GA | 5.5%(48) |
| 4 | Flat Rock Middle School | Tyrone, GA | 3.8%(30) |
| 5 | Whitewater Middle School | Fayetteville, GA | 3.4%(30) |
| 6 | Utopian Academy for the Arts Trilith | Fayetteville, GA | 0.7%(1) |
